摘要
We describe a novel, regioselective alkylboration of versatile (hetero)benzylidenecyclopropanes with beta-H-containing alkyl iodides and bis(pinacolato)diboron enabled by copper catalysis. This three-component method allows for consecutive B-Csp(3) and Csp(3)-Csp(3) bond formation to access Csp(3)-enriched diverse tertiary cyclopropyl boronic esters with broad functionality tolerance, and the so-formed C-B bond is amenable to further structural diversification. Radical clock experiment, Hammett analysis, and DFT calculation suggest a mechanism of polar, rather than radical manifold, and S(N)2-type C-C bond formation was found to be the rate-limiting step instead of migratory alkene insertion.
